Test Pattern 2: Color-to-color Alignment
If the printer has color-to-color alignment problems
then the Image Quality Print in test pattern 2 (shown
below) has misaligned colors.
Corrective Action
1. Perform the Aligning the Printheads
with the
same media you were experiencing unacceptable
image quality.
2. If there is no improvement in print quality, contact
Hewlett Packard.
Test Pattern 3: Bi-directional Alignment
If a printer has bi-directional alignment problems, lines
are not straight and/or fuzzy. The pattern seen below is
designed to highlight this kind of problem. Check the
lines on this test pattern, if they have any defects like
the ones described above perform the corrective
action.
Corrective Action
1. Perform the Aligning the Printheads
with the
same media you were experiencing unacceptable
image quality.
2. If there is no improvement in print quality, contact
Hewlett-Packard.
